Big win for the girls over #3 Minnesota tonight.

They also tied an NCAA record for most consecutive wins with 32 (set by UW in 2007).

The Badgers came out strong, netting 3 in the first period (including 2 in the first 4 minutes) and that held for the rest of the game. The Gophers out-shot the Badgers 13-5 in the third period and after a penalty late in the game, pulled their goalie and skated 6-4, but Rigsby held up and Wisconsin won 3-2.

Per Andy Baggott's article that I can't seem to cut and paste, UW is putting together a bid to host the 2014 NCAA Final Four to be held at Kohl Center.

Madison is way overdue for both the NCAA Final Four and/or the WCHA Frozen Four, but facilities have always been an issue. I'm still surprised that there would be an open weekend in March for Kohl Center. Badger men's hockey and the state tournaments usually take up all the weekends.

I would love to see it here, but the article says one obstacle would be that Duluth is hosting this year and Minneapolis the next. Three WCHA sites in a row would definitely be surprising. But maybe since the league has owned the NCAA title from Day 1, it should host more Final Fours. Plus, UW may make an offer that the NCAA can't refuse. If the Badgers got in to a Madison Final Four, an attendence record would most certainly be set.

Interesting to see how this will play out.
